Veggie and Hummus Sandwich

A healthy, hearty, delicious sandwich! A great way to eat lots of vegetables at once! Whole grain bread is layered with fresh hummus, spinach, cucumber, avocado, tomato, red onion, sprouts and cheese.

Servings: 2

Prep20 minutesReady in: 20 minutes

Ingredients4 slices hearty whole grain bread, toasted1/3 cup hummus, see notes for recipe2 slices havarti or provolone cheese (optional)1 cup spinach1/2 cup peeled and grated carrots8 peeled cucumber slices6 avocado slices4 tomato slicesSaltSmall handful sliced red onion (optional), rinsed under water1/2 cup broccoli or alfalfa sprouts

InstructionsFor the sandwiches: Spread hummus over bread slices. Divide sandwich ingredients over two of the slices, season lightly with salt to taste (preferably over the tomato or cucumber layer). Top with remaining slices. Serve immediately.
